venerdì 29 dicembre 2017

Skype per Linux

Al seguente indirizzo è disponibile l’ultima versione di Skype

download skype

Tramite console andare nella directory dove si è salvato il file.
A seconda che si sia scaricato il file .deb o .rpm
dare i comandi:
#sudo dpkg -i skypeforlinux-64.deb
#sudo rpm -i skypeforlinux-64.rpm

Visto che il corretto funzionamento dipende anche dall’ambiente grafico installato, potrebbe accadere che se si utilizza KDE alcuni pacchetti o servizi non siano installati, questo comporta che ad ogni avvio vengano richieste le credenziali e la configurazione.
Verificare che siano installati i pacchetti:
gnome-keyring e libgnome-keyring0

#dpkg -l | grep gnome-keyring
ii  gnome-keyring 3.20.1-2 amd64 GNOME keyring services (daemon and tools)
ii  libgnome-keyring-common 3.12.0-1 all GNOME keyring services library - data files
ii  libgnome-keyring0:amd64  3.12.0-1+b2 amd64 GNOME keyring services library

Se questi pacchetti non dovessero esserci, dare i comandi:
#sudo apt-get install gnome-keyring libgnome-keyring0

#sudo yum install gnome-keyring libgnome-keyring0

Cancellare file per data

Spostarsi nella directory su cui agire
Per visualizzare i file per data dare il comando:
ls -ltrh
se i file sono numerosi, dare:
ls -ltrh | more
Per cancellare i file più vecchi di una data e ora specifica:
find . -name "*.php" -not -newermt "2017-09-30 1000" -exec rm {} \;

 il comando cercherà tutti i file con estensione .php
l'opzione newermt filtra i file più recenti di una certa data
l'opzione not inverte il senso, ottenendo i file più vecchi della data impostata.
la data imposta indica: anno-mese-giorno ore minuti
l'opzione exec, esegue il comando rm

Script Python per accesso agli switch Cisco

Di seguito uno script Python che esegue l'accesso a due switch (possibile estendere la lista aggiungendo più IP) e fa lo show version Lo...